Microchip Technology, based in Chandler, Arizona, with a manufacturing and design site in Colorado Springs, has announced that they are opening a new design center focused on analog and power engineering. Cecilia Harry, the Chamber & EDC’s chief economic development officer, has been elected to serve on the board of directors for the ACCE Foundation, a 501(c)3 that supports the work of the Association of Chamber of Commerce Executives. Emerging tech company Bluestaq named to Inc.’s 2021 Best Workplaces list and is a winner in the On the Rise: 0-4 years in business category. Bluestaq LLC, an emerging tech company specializing in secure data management platforms and complex software solutions, has been named to Inc. magazine’s annual list of the Best Workplaces for 2021.
